Team 66 Scouting System

I have an offer for any team that is NOT in the Curie Division for nationals.

Team 66 has spent this season developing and implementing a scouting system that has become very reliable. The system--after you have input all the required data--will rank every team (in your division) from top to bottom. It will rank them objectively, subjectively, and overall. Using the overall ranking system Team 66 has been able to accurately predict approximately 88% of the teams picked for the finals. The downlside to this scouting system is that it requires every to team to be scouted every match. This means at the bare minimum 6 people must be scouting the field at all times. My offer is to a maximum of two teams in Galileo, Archimedes, and Newton. I will send you a fully operational copy of our program as well provide instruction for its use. In return I request that your team make full use of the program for nationals, as well as share all of the data you have aquired with Team 66. Feedback would also be welcomed. A laptop with Microsoft Excel is also required for this program.
